#1266bd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1266bd is composed of 7.1% red, 40%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.5% cyan, 46%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 210.5 degrees, a saturation of 82.6% and a lightness of 40.6%. #1266bd color hex could be obtained by blending #24ccff with #00007b.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

#1266bd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1266bd has RGB values of R:18, G:102, B:189 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0.46,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 1205949.

Shades and Tints of #1266bd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01050a is the darkest color, while #f7fbfe is the lightest one.
